Output 23673322ef8c5d119f284d6f46a330b75b929b3cb68f62d66584d16b06d4e710:50

value
3241481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cda8bbbc5bacfed3a9328112e6f9e02e232295b OP_EQUAL
address
34KaekCyPhH4a429CKXWftgqrt194cKDBh
transaction
23673322ef8c5d119f284d6f46a330b75b929b3cb68f62d66584d16b06d4e710